    At APEC 2024, Chinese leader Xi tells Biden he’s ‘ready to work’ with Trump | Politics News

    Chinese language President Xi Jinping has held his final meeting together with his outgoing counterpart in the US, Democrat Joe Biden.

    However Xi’s phrases on Saturday appeared directed not merely at Biden however at his Republican successor, returning President Donald Trump.

    In his encounter with Biden on the sidelines of the Asia-Pacific Economic Cooperation summit in Lima, Peru, Xi emphasised the significance of the US and China sustaining “mutual respect”.

    Whereas Xi didn’t point out Trump by identify, he gave a nod to the incoming US president’s victory within the November 5 election.

    “America has lately concluded its elections. China’s objective of a steady, wholesome and sustainable China-US relationship stays unchanged,” Xi stated.

    However, he warned, “If we take one another as rival or adversary, pursue vicious competitors and search to harm one another, we’d roil the connection and even set it again.”

    Trump, who served as president beforehand from 2017 to 2021, oversaw a interval of heightened tensions with China, together with a commerce struggle sparked by his imposition of tariffs on Chinese goods.

    China responded with its personal tariffs and commerce restrictions, although experts warned that the escalation on each side damaged the two countries’ economies.

    On Saturday, Xi appeared to increase a hand of friendship to Trump, encouraging their nations to work collectively for mutual achieve.

    “China is able to work with the brand new US administration to keep up communication, develop cooperation and handle variations in order to attempt for a gentle transition of the China-US relationship for the good thing about the 2 peoples,” he stated.

    US President Joe Biden and China’s President Xi Jinping attend a bilateral assembly on the sidelines of the APEC Summit in Lima, Peru, on November 16 [Leah Millis/Reuters]

    A significant marketing campaign theme

    Trump has reprised his “America First” philosophy as he prepares to enter the White Home for a second time.

    China was a repeated function of the Republican’s marketing campaign speeches, as he led a profitable bid for re-election within the 2024 US presidential race.

    As a part of a pitch to American voters, Trump pledged to protect US manufacturing from Chinese language competitors.

    “I charged China lots of of billions of {dollars} in taxes and tariffs. They paid us,” Trump boasted at his closing marketing campaign rally in Grand Rapids, Michigan, on November 4.

    “And what? We’re going to get alongside nice with China. We’re going to get alongside good. I need to get together with them. President Xi was nice till COVID got here. Then, I wasn’t so thrilled with him.”

    Throughout the top of the COVID-19 pandemic, Trump blamed the Chinese language chief for letting the virus unfold by “permitting flights to depart China and infect the world”. He additionally repeatedly known as COVID-19 the “China virus”.

    Regardless of their rocky historical past, Xi known as to congratulate Trump on his second time period the day after the election, on November 6.

    Xi has led the Chinese language authorities since 2013, and beneath his authority, the two-term restrict was abolished for presidents.

    Trump has expressed admiration for Xi’s authority over the Chinese language authorities, which some critics evaluate with authoritarian rule.

    “I received alongside very nicely with President Xi. He’s an amazing man. He wrote me an attractive notice the opposite day when he heard about what occurred,” Trump stated after the assassination attempt on him in July. “It’s factor to get alongside, not a nasty factor.”

    Goodbye to Biden

    Xi and Biden have had their very own rocky historical past, with incidents just like the 2023 downing of an alleged Chinese language “spy” balloon fuelling spikes in tensions.

    China maintained that the balloon was a civilian plane accumulating climate knowledge, and it denounced the US’s choice to shoot it down with a missile after it handed over delicate US army installations.

    Biden, who turns 82 on Wednesday, exchanged some banter together with his Chinese language counterpart as they spoke to reporters of their closing meeting.

    “Can you place in your earpiece? We’ve simultaneous deciphering,” Xi requested Biden at their afternoon information convention.

    Biden responded with a joke. “I’ve realized to talk Chinese language,” he stated with a chuckle.

    The US president continued by acknowledging that relations haven’t at all times been easy between their two nations.

    “We haven’t at all times agreed, however our conversations have at all times been candid and at all times been frank. We’ve by no means kidded each other. We’ve been stage with each other. And I believe that’s very important,” Biden stated, pointing throughout the desk as he learn from ready remarks.

    “These conversations stop miscalculations, and so they make sure the competitors between our two nations won’t veer into battle.”

    He used his closing encounter as president with Xi to push a number of US priorities. In a readout launched by the White Home, Biden reportedly pushed for better regulation enforcement cooperation to stem the circulation of artificial medication to the US.

    He and Xi additionally spoke concerning the rising challenges posed by synthetic intelligence (AI), together with on the subject of its use with nuclear weapons.

    “The 2 leaders affirmed the necessity to keep human management over the choice to make use of nuclear weapons,” the readout defined.

    “The 2 leaders additionally confused the necessity to contemplate rigorously the potential dangers and develop AI know-how within the army subject in a prudent and accountable method.”

    Biden additionally confirmed that the US’s “one China coverage” remained “unchanged”: The US acknowledges the federal government in Beijing as the only real authorities of China. It doesn’t have formal diplomatic relations with the self-governing island of Taiwan, which China considers its territory.

    China has known as acknowledging Taiwan’s sovereignty a “crimson line” in its relationship with the US.

    Whereas Biden has beforehand pledged to guard Taiwan ought to it ever face assault, on Saturday, he struck a notice of peace, calling for a continuation of the established order.

    “He reiterated that the US opposes any unilateral modifications to the established order from both facet, that we anticipate cross-Strait variations to be resolved by peaceable means, and that the world has an curiosity in peace and stability within the Taiwan Strait,” the White Home readout stated.

    However, it added, Biden additionally “known as for an finish to destabilizing PRC [People’s Republic of China] army exercise round Taiwan”.
